> >Approximately 30,000 people in the United States die by gunfire every year
> >and nearly twice that number are treated in emergency rooms for nonfatal
> >firearm injuries. Yet guns, unlike other inherently dangerous products
> >(e.g. prescription drugs or household chemicals), are not regulated for
> >health and safety. Even non-inherently dangerous products, such as
> >children's teddy bears, are regulated (see enclosed booklet for more
> >information). The history of consumer product regulation teaches us that a
> >significant number of deaths and injuries can be prevented as a result of
> >health and safety standards. CCHCC has received a grant from the Consumer
> >Federation of America (CFA) and the Joyce Foundation to work from a public
> >health and consumer advocacy perspective to mobilize public support for
> >legislation to regulate guns.
